|
Лимит времени 2000/4000/4000/4000 мс. Лимит памяти 65000/65000/65000/65000 Кб.
Тимлид Василий каждый день проводит звонки с коллегами.
Количество звонков давно уже выходит за пределы разумного. У каждого звонка есть очень условное время начала, время окончания и его приоритет.
Утешение Василий находит в том, что из-за пересечений расписания он не попадает на некоторые звонки. Если звонки пересекаются, то Василий всегда выбирает для посещения звонки с наибольшим приоритетом.
Получив расписание звонков Василия, найдите сумму приоритетов звонков, которые он пропустит и порадуется.
Формат входных данных
Строка целых положительных чисел, разделенных пробелом, где:
- первое число N (1 ≤ N ≤ 10000) - количество звонков;
- каждые последующие N троек целых чисел: начало звонка (натуральное число), конец звонка (натуральное число), приоритет звонка (натуральное число).
Формат выходных данных
Единственное целое число — сумма приоритетов звонков, которые Василий пропустит из-за пересечений в расписании.
Пример
стандартный ввод
|
5 9 11 15 10 12 10 11 13 12 12 14 8 13 15 14
|
стандартный вывод
|
18
|
Примечание: Значение приоритетов звонков могут повторяться, но никогда два звонка с одним приоритетом не пересекаются.
Для отправки решений необходимо выполнить вход.
|